goodbyemotel are a collective of artists who immerse themselves in music, art and film. The band combine music, film and photography to create a unique musical and visual live show experience. The band features members who are directors, editors, producers and photographers, but most of all, passionate musicians.
The band perform live shows backed by a lighting and video show that they created themselves to add to the live performance experience. Each show has a theme attached to it which inspires the media content created for the show. The current show is called “end of excess”. As well as these shows goodbyemotel also play straight live shows without the production extravaganza.
While film is certainly relevant, writing great music is at the heart of the band. goodbyemotel’s music features crescendos, sparse arrangements and rich melodies combined with pop sensibilities to great something original.
2009 has so far seen goodbyemotel start to tour the “end of excess” live show as well as finish recording their debut album, which will be released later in the year.
Storm Thorgerson, the album designer, who created album sleeves for Led Zepplin, Muse, Peter Gabriel and most of Pink Floyd’s covers including “Darkside of the moon” has agreed to do goodbyemotel’s artwork for their debut album. Being huge Pink Floyd fans this was a major coup for the guys who are incredibly proud to be working with Storm.
